Kamoto Copper Company Société Anonyme, KCC SA in acronym, is a Congolese company operating in Kolwezi, capital of the province of Lualaba, in the Democratic Republic of Congo.
KCC SA exploits copper and cobalt ores on a large scale. It includes an underground mine, open-pit mines and integrated metallurgical facilities. The operation has one of the largest copper reserves in the world, with a current life of over 25 years.

job description
Reporting directly to the Metal Accounting Superintendent , the incumbent will be responsible for ensuring the accuracy, integrity, and validation of data related to copper and cobalt flows. Under the Superintendent's supervision, they will prepare metal balance sheets, reconcile inventories, and provide the technical reporting necessary for operational and financial requirements. Responsible for compliance with AMIRA P754, they will conduct statistical investigations to identify discrepancies and optimize process performance. This strategic role supports decision-making through rigorous analysis of data from the mine, laboratory, and plant.
He/She will have, among other things, the following responsibilities (non-exhaustive):
- Oversee the monitoring of flows and the integrity of metallurgical data: This includes coordinating all technical metal accounting activities across the mine site. This includes the collection, validation, and consolidation of production, inventory, and laboratory data, while ensuring complete traceability of metals from plant feed to exported finished products.
- Managing the development of metal balances and variance analysis: This includes maintaining and reviewing daily, weekly, and monthly balances for copper and cobalt. It also includes accurately calculating recovery rates and losses, as well as conducting root cause analyses to explain any metallurgical anomalies or variances detected in the system.
- Validating laboratory data and sampling processes: This includes close collaboration with laboratory teams to review test quality and monitor for analytical biases. It also includes systematically investigating inconsistencies between ore volumes processed and analytical results to ensure the accuracy of data entered into management systems.
- Managing the reconciliation of metallurgical and reagent stocks: This includes rigorously tracking raw material, work-in-process (WIP), and finished goods stocks through regular physical inventories. It also includes reconciling chemical reagent consumption and providing technical support during internal or external audits to justify stock movements.
- Develop reporting tools and production forecasts: This includes preparing and presenting detailed performance reports and interactive dashboards (via Excel or Power BI). It also includes updating copper production forecasts by coordinating input from the Mining and Metallurgy departments, while ensuring the reliability of the forecasting models.
- Providing financial support, compliance, and continuous improvement: This includes assisting the Finance department with monthly closings and preparing supporting documentation for auditors. It also includes strict adherence to internal controls and the AMIRA P754 code, while collaborating with the IT department to stabilize and improve digital metal accounting systems.
- Exercising leadership and developing team skills: This includes mentoring and coaching Metal Accounting Officers to meet their training needs. It also includes promoting industry best practices, communicating clear expectations, and maintaining a work environment aligned with HSE requirements and company values.
